Historic Fall Enrollment for Southwest Arkansas College

By: Brian Kushida, KTAL-TV, Shreveport
Updated: September 6, 2012
A Southwest Arkansas college system is celebrating an historic Fall enrollment.

The University of Arkansas Community College at Hope (UACCH) reports higher-than-expected student numbers at its Texarkana campus.

A UACCH spokesperson says the high enrollment numbers have helped push the system's total enrollment past 1,500 for the second time in the system's history.

Elected officials gathered on campus Wednesday morning to celebrate the opening of the campus with a ribbon-cutting.
